The global electric ships market is segmented based on various factors such as system, ship type, and vessel. The system segment includes energy storage, power conversion, power generation, power transmission, and others. Energy storage systems are crucial for electric ships as they store energy that is generated for powering the vessel. Power conversion systems help in converting the stored energy into usable power for the ship's operation. Power generation systems are responsible for generating the electricity needed for the ship to function efficiently. Power transmission and other systems also play vital roles in ensuring the smooth operation of electric ships. Ship type segmentation includes battery electric ships, plug-in hybrid electric ships, hybrid electric ships, and fully electric ships. Each type has its own unique characteristics and advantages, catering to different needs and preferences of the market. The vessel segment comprises commercial and defense vessels, indicating the diverse applications of electric ships in various sectors.

The global electric ships market is currently experiencing a significant shift towards sustainable and eco-friendly transportation solutions. The rising concerns regarding environmental pollution and the need to reduce carbon footprint are driving the adoption of electric propulsion systems in the maritime industry. As governments worldwide are implementing stringent regulations to curb emissions from marine vessels, the demand for electric ships is expected to witness substantial growth in the coming years. Market players are focusing on developing innovative technologies to enhance the efficiency and performance of electric ships, thereby creating a competitive landscape in the industry.
One of the key trends shaping the electric ships market is the increasing investment in research and development activities. Companies such as ABB, Wärtsilä, and Siemens are heavily investing in R&D to introduce cutting-edge solutions that address the challenges associated with electric propulsion systems. These efforts are aimed at improving energy storage capabilities, power conversion efficiency, and overall system reliability to meet the evolving needs of the maritime sector. Additionally, advancements in battery technology, power electronics, and control systems are enabling the development of more sustainable and cost-effective electric ships.
Another significant trend in the electric ships market is the growing focus on collaboration and strategic partnerships among industry players. Companies like Corvus Energy, General Electric, and MAN Energy Solutions are forming alliances to leverage each other's expertise and capabilities in developing integrated solutions for electric vessels. These collaborations not only facilitate knowledge sharing but also lead to the accelerated commercialization of new technologies in the market. By joining forces, market players can collectively address the challenges related to infrastructure development, regulatory compliance, and market acceptance of electric ships.
Moreover, the market for electric ships is witnessing a shift towards customized solutions for different ship types and vessel applications. As the demand for battery electric ships, plug-in hybrid electric ships, and fully electric ships grows, manufacturers are diversifying their product portfolios to cater to specific customer requirements. Commercial vessels, such as ferries, cruise ships, and cargo carriers, are increasingly adopting electric propulsion systems to reduce operating costs and comply with environmental regulations. On the other hand, defense vessels are also exploring the benefits of electric propulsion for enhancing operational efficiency and mission readiness.
